🧠 核心概念
软件工程(Software Engineering) 📚
以系统化、规范化、可量化的方法开发和维护软件的学科,融合计算机科学、工程学与管理学。敏捷开发(Agile Development) 🚀
强调迭代开发、协作与快速响应变化的软件开发方法论。瀑布模型(Waterfall Model) 🌊
经典的线性开发流程,分需求、设计、编码、测试、部署等阶段。
🔧 常用术语
术语 | 中文解释 | 英文解释 |
---|---|---|
API | 应用程序编程接口 | Application Programming Interface |
CI/CD | 持续集成与持续交付 | Continuous Integration/Continuous Delivery |
UML | 统一建模语言 | Unified Modeling Language |
Scrum | 敏捷框架,强调团队协作与迭代 | Agile framework focusing on teamwork and iteration |
📚 扩展阅读
如需深入了解软件工程领域的专业术语与实践,可访问软件工程术语解释页面。